Definition & Meaning of "heap"

Heap
01

a large number of objects thrown on top of each other in an untidy way

The children made a heap of toys in the corner of the room.
She found a heap of papers that needed sorting through.
02

a lot of something; a large amount of something

03

a car that is old and unreliable

to heap
01

to pile or gather things in a disorderly or untidy manner

After the harvest, the farmers heaped the freshly picked apples in wooden crates.
In the warehouse, workers heaped boxes and packages to organize the inventory efficiently.
02

bestow in large quantities

03

fill to overflow
